31300231244 has 6 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 54775404684. Its totient is φ = 15650115620.
The previous prime is 31300231223. The next prime is 31300231247. The reversal of 31300231244 is 44213200313.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(31300231247)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 3912528902 + ... + 3912528909.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(9129234114).
Almost surely, 231300231244 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
31300231244 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(23475173440).
31300231244 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
31300231244 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 7825057815 (or 7825057813 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 1728, while the sum is 23.
Adding to 31300231244 its reverse (44213200313), we get a palindrome (75513431557).
The spelling of 31300231244 in words is "thirty-one billion, three hundred million, two hundred thirty-one thousand, two hundred forty-four".
